Dreams FC head coach Karim Zito has criticized the media’s negative portrayal of coaches, calling it a major obstacle to Ghana’s football development.
He believes constant criticism hampers long-term progress and emphasizes the need for a structured football system similar to European models, where young players transition seamlessly into senior teams.
*"The media keeps attacking coaches instead of supporting long-term growth. We focus too much on instant results, but strong foundations are essential for success,"* Zito stated.
He cited Coach Sellas Tetteh’s 2009 U-20 World Cup-winning squad as an example of effective player development.
Zito urged the Ghana Football Association (GFA) to implement a clear succession plan to ensure a steady talent pipeline and restore Ghana’s football dominance.
